Demonetisation: RBI Governor Urjit Patel to brief Parliamentary panel today
New Delhi: Reserve Bank Governor Urjit Patel will brief the Parliamentary Committee on Finance about the demonetisation procedure and its effect on Monday.
Since banning of old 500 and 1000 rupee notes on the eighth of a month ago, the Government has taken a large group of measures like Service Tax sops and motivators for advance computerized installment and dial down issues emerging out of less cash being accessible in the market.
RBI a week ago said that 12.44 lakh crore rupees in demonetised notes have been gathered at banks. Likewise, banks have issued 4.61 lakh crore rupees to the general population since November 8-9 through ATMs and bank counters.
